Average Salary after Completing College/Postsecondary/University Teaching Program

The following table shows the average earning of students three years after completing the College/Postsecondary/University Teaching program by degree type. The average earning after graduation is $37,528 for bachelor's degree and $49,212 for master degree programs.
DegreeAverage EarningAverage Loan Debt
Undergraduate Certificate or Diploma$22,281$8,840
Associate's Degree$23,068$12,673
Bachelor's Degree$37,528$23,860
Post-baccalaureate Certificate$47,677$12,500
Master's Degree$49,212$31,130
Doctoral Degree$75,690$69,077
First Professional Degree$49,340-
Graduate/Professional Certificate$56,223$60,280
